Platte-Clay Electric Cooperative is a member-owned electric utility serving the Kansas City Northland region, delivering power across Buchanan, Caldwell, Clay, Clinton, DeKalb, Platte, and Ray Counties, along about 3,100 miles of energized lines to more than 26,500 active services. The organization was founded in 1938 and is considered one of Missouri's faster-growing electric cooperatives. It is affiliated with Touchstone Energy, a national alliance of member-owned rural electric cooperatives operating in 46 states. Based in Kearney, Missouri, the cooperative functions as a mid-sized regional energy provider serving a mix of urban and rural customers in the Kansas City area. Its extensive line network and service footprint reflect its role as a local, member-owned utility within a broader rural electricity network. In December 2024, Platte-Clay Electric Co-op partnered with Meals of Hope to package 10,000 pasta meals for area food pantries, reflecting community engagement beyond its core grid operations.
